Verb
- 1 To prove satisfactory; to be successful or worthy of merit. idiomatic
"Near-synonym: fit the bill"
Example
More examples"In 1916 the famed Van Sweringen brothers bought their first railroad—the Nickel Plate. . . . This year, as usual, the tarnished Nickel Plate cannot make the grade. In first seven months it lost $2,003,779."
Etymology
Probably from a railway train climbing a length of track sloping uphill (a grade).
